Sadie R. Sheehy, 90, Indianapolis, formerly of Cloverdale, died Friday at Community East Hospital, Indianapolis.

Born in Indianapolis, she was the daughter of George and Della (Dove) Morgan.

She married Thomas J. Sheehy on June 4, 1943. He preceded her in death on Oct. 25, 1977.

She was a 1932 graduate of Ben Davis High School and was a homemaker. She was a member of the Cloverdale United Methodist Church, a former member of Lynhurst Baptist Church, and was instrumental in the start-up of the Cloverdale Little League as its first scorekeeper.

Survivors include daughter Marylyn Paul, Westfield; sons retired Col. Thomas J. Sheehy II and wife Michalene, Fairfax, Va., Edwin R. McIntosh and wife Sherrie, Magnolia, Ky., and Stanton P. McIntosh, Chicago; sisters Maye Wood, Indianapolis, Faye Gramse, Chicago Heights, Ill.; six grandchildren, and seven great-gr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by her husband, parents, sisters Freda Clearwater and Mary Virginia Jones; and brothers Paul Morgan, George T. Morgan, Thomas Morgan, Harold Morgan and infant twin brothers.
